Abstract: | Treatment of a benzene or a CH2Cl2 solution of bis(N,N-dimethylcarbamoylseleno)methanes with SnCl4 afforded β-1,3,5-triselenanes, and the key intermediates, acylselonium ions and selenoaldehydes, were successfully trapped by using allyltrimethylsilane or 2,3-dimethyl-1,3-butadiene to obtain the allylation products or the cycloadducts, respectively. |
